John Briscoe

Professor of the Practice of Environmental Engineering and Health (joint with the Harvard School of Public Health)

https://wwwnew.seas.harvard.edu/directory/jbriscoe/image_normal

Areas: Engineering and Economic Development

John Briscoe's career has focused on the issues of water and economic development. He has worked: as an engineer in the water agencies of South Africa and Mozambique; as an epidemiologist at the Cholera Research Center in Bangladesh; as a professor of water resources at the University of North Carolina; and, for the past 20 years in a variety of policy and operational positions in the World Bank.

Most recently he has served as the Bank’s Senior Water Advisor and the Country Director for Brazil.

He received his Ph.D. in Environmental Engineering at Harvard University and his B.Sc. in Civil Engineering at the University of Cape Town, South Africa. In addition to the United States, Briscoe has lived in his native South Africa, Bangladesh, Mozambique, India and Brazil. He speaks English, Afrikaans, Bengali, Portuguese, and Spanish.

Briscoe has served on the Water Science and Technology Board of the National Academy of Sciences and was a founding member of the major global water partnerships, including the World Water Council, the Global Water Partnership, and the World Commission on Dams.

He currently serves on the Global Agenda Council of the World Economic Forum; is a member of the Council of Distinguished Water Professionals of the International Water Association; and will be the first Natural Resource Fellow of the Council on Foreign Relations.

He has published extensively in economic, finance, environmental, health and engineering journals. Recently he authored Water Sector Strategy, India's Water Economy: Bracing for a Turbulent Future, and Pakistan’s Water Economy: Running Dry.
